Noun

1. mardi gras, pancake day, shrove tuesday

the last day before Lent

2. fat tuesday, mardi gras

a carnival held in some countries on Shrove Tuesday (the last day before Lent) but especially in New Orleans

n.
1.
a. Shrove Tuesday, celebrated as a holiday in many places with carnivals, masquerade balls, and parades of costumed merrymakers.
b. A carnival period coming to a climax on this day.
2. An occasion of great festivity and merrymaking.
